首页 > 科技 >

SQL语句(Order by)两个字段同时排序 📊🔍

发布时间:2025-03-07 16:26:55来源:

在处理数据库查询时,有时我们需要对结果进行更精细的控制,以便获得更准确的数据展示。这时,使用`ORDER BY`子句对多个字段进行排序就显得尤为重要了。通过指定多个字段,我们可以实现更复杂的数据排列逻辑。比如,我们可能希望首先按照某个日期字段降序排列,然后在同一天的数据中再按另一个数字字段升序排列。这种情况下,只需在`ORDER BY`后列出你想要排序的所有字段,并指定每个字段的排序方式即可。例如:

```sql

SELECT FROM 表名

ORDER BY 日期字段 DESC, 数字字段 ASC;

```

在这个例子中,数据会先按照`日期字段`从大到小排序,对于相同日期的数据,则会按照`数字字段`从小到大排序。这使得查询结果更加符合我们的需求,也方便了后续的数据分析和处理。掌握这一技巧,可以帮助你在处理大量数据时更加得心应手,提高工作效率。🚀📈

(注:实际使用时,请将示例中的"表名"、"日期字段"和"数字字段"替换为你的具体表名和字段名)

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。